Transaction 57d5b3f7272e4db516c7a8a7e56170decd9ea7a61ec678d1b16325c7dc368e40
3 Input
2 Outputs
- 57d5b3f7272e4db516c7a8a7e56170decd9ea7a61ec678d1b16325c7dc368e40:0
- 57d5b3f7272e4db516c7a8a7e56170decd9ea7a61ec678d1b16325c7dc368e40:1
value 6577881
address 15VHoHN3Qao1qfb7RZpikujxxrShT3FbQm
value 5000000
address 1DzYA9JUPftaLHyqpaCR1VkUhuCrfZr6GV